Job Title: Power Electronics Mechanical Packaging Engineer

Job Description

We are looking for someone that has experience in designing product packages for power electronics. The ideal candidate will design small metal/plastic enclosures that house PCBs, Bus Bars, heatsinks, fans, etc.

Job Responsibilities:

•\tWork with others to bring our rapid prototype designs to market (creating new 3D Model packaging/layout using SOLIDWORKS).

•\tEnsure the designs are accurate and consistent with standard manufacturing/assembly processes.

•\tMaintain revision control for individual components for each part to ensure configuration is controlled at each phase.

•\tDesign HW packaging for high power power electronics in enclosures considering EMC, EMI, thermal, and other requirements.

•\tWorks with system engineering to capture system requirements for utilizing the packages in the system architecture.

•\tWorks with service to create service plans and documentation for maintanence and repair of products.

•\tUtilizes DFM (Design For Manufacturing) and DFA (Design For Assembly) practices during the design process
